ARC1178I
DFSMSHSM NOT AT SUFFICIENT LEVEL

Explanation

RECALL or RECOVER command processing of the data set failed because DFSMShsm is not at a sufficient level. Message ARC1001I precedes this message, giving the data set name and the reascode.

The reascode value gives the reason the RECALL or RECOVER processing could not be done. Valid values for reascode are:
Reascode
Meaning
5
The current level of DFSMShsm cannot recall or recover an extended format data set (sequential striped or compressed). A minimum of DFSMShsm 1.1.0 is required for sequential striped data sets, and a minimum of DFSMShsm 1.2.0 is required for extended format compressed data sets.

System action

The RECALL or RECOVER processing of the data set ends. DFSMShsm processing continues.

Programmer response

It may be possible to issue the RECALL or RECOVER command from a different processing unit in a multiple processing unit environment. Otherwise, a sufficient level of DFSMShsm must be installed on the system.
